Understanding the Role of Resistors ⁢in LED Brightness ‍Control

Resistors play a pivotal role in controlling the ​brightness of LED light ⁣bulbs by regulating ‌the amount of current that flows through them.⁢ By introducing a specific⁤ resistance to the electrical ⁢circuit,they‍ effectively reduce the energy fed‌ into the LED,allowing for varied brightness levels.The basic⁤ principle here is Ohm’s ‌Law, which states that V = I ‍x R. In this case, V ⁣ represents voltage, I is ⁢the current,⁣ and R is ⁤the resistance. So, by selecting an appropriate resistor, you‌ can create dimmable effects or⁤ achieve desirable lighting conditions, catering to different ambiance‌ needs.

Moreover, using a resistor for ⁤LED brightness control offers a straightforward and cost-effective solution‌ compared to more complex electronic dimmers. Here are some ⁣key points ⁢regarding their use:

  • Simple ⁤Integration: Resistors can be ‍easily added‍ to existing circuits without⁣ requiring major modifications.
  • Cost-Effective: ​ They are typically inexpensive and readily available components.
  • Heat Management: While ‌they can⁣ generate ⁢heat, ⁢proper ‍sizing ensures safety ⁢and ​efficiency.

The‌ Impact of⁢ Capacitors on LED⁢ Light Performance

Capacitors⁢ play⁢ a crucial role in determining the brightness and ⁢longevity of LED⁤ light bulbs, influencing their overall performance in important ways.‍ These components store and release electrical energy, helping to smooth out voltage fluctuations that‍ can​ cause LEDs to flicker ⁤or‍ dim⁣ unexpectedly. By providing a steady electrical supply, capacitors ⁢help maintain consistent light ​output, ⁤improving not only the⁤ quality of ​illumination but also extending the life span ‍of⁣ the LED. The use ⁢of capacitors⁢ can also enhance energy efficiency, minimizing‌ wasted power that may⁤ occur when the​ LED is subjected to inconsistent voltage levels.

When‌ considering the quality‍ of capacitors in LED‌ circuits, several factors come into play,⁤ such as capacitance value,‌ voltage ‍rating, and type⁤ of capacitor used. A summary of these ‍factors includes:

  • Capacitance Value: Higher capacitance ‍can ‌led ‌to better performance but might increase size.
  • Voltage ‍Rating: ‌Must exceed the maximum voltage in⁤ the circuit to prevent failure.
  • Type: ⁤ Electrolytic, ceramic, or‌ film ⁤capacitors ‌can effect performance differently.

The selection ⁤of⁢ the appropriate capacitor ‍type ⁢substantially impacts‌ the ⁣behavior of ‌the LED light. Selecting the Right Transistors for Enhanced ⁤LED Functionality

When it ‍comes to ​fine-tuning ​LED performance, the selection ⁤of​ transistors⁣ plays a pivotal role in ⁣achieving desired ⁢effects​ like fading and dimming.Transistors act as electronic switches or amplifiers, controlling ‍the current delivered to the LEDs. ⁤Different ‌types ⁤of transistors offer​ distinct characteristics, impacting the ⁤fading speed⁢ and ‌smoothness of ‌the ⁤LED light. It’s essential to consider parameters​ such as the switching speed, gain, and maximum ‌current ⁢ratings. As‌ a​ notable example, MOSFETs are frequently⁢ enough⁣ preferred ⁢for their high-efficiency switching capabilities and low on-resistance, ideal for applications requiring⁤ gradual⁢ fading. Alternatively, common BJT transistors may be⁤ favored for⁢ projects emphasizing simple control circuits.

For optimal fading effects,it’s beneficial to ‍categorize‌ commonly used ‍transistor types along with‌ their⁣ main attributes. Here’s a concise comparison ​that highlights key ⁣specifications:

Transistor Type Switching⁤ speed Control Method Ideal⁣ Use Case
MOSFET high Voltage Control Complex Fading
BJT Moderate Current Control Simple Dimming
IGBT Moderate Voltage & Current ‍Control high-Power Applications

in ‍addition to the type, the configuration ⁢of the⁢ circuit also influences⁢ the LED’s ⁣fading quality. ‌Transistors can ⁢be used in ‌switching ​or ‌linear configurations, each‍ affecting​ how the current flows ⁣to the LED.while a ⁤linear configuration can provide smooth dimming, it‌ may⁢ generate excess‍ heat‌ due to⁤ continuous⁤ current flow. ⁤on ‌the​ other hand,a⁣ switching configuration ​is‍ highly efficient,allowing precise⁢ control⁤ with less heat generation,making it suitable for intricate fading effects. ⁣Ensuring that the chosen transistor aligns with ⁢the‍ project ⁢goals amplifies not‌ just the functionality but also the longevity‍ of LED installations.

Q1: ‌What dose ​it mean for⁤ an‍ LED light bulb to “fade”?
A1: Fading ⁢in⁣ the context‌ of an LED ⁢light bulb typically‍ refers to⁣ a gradual ⁢decrease ⁤in brightness ​or a⁤ change ‌in the color ⁢temperature of the ‌light emitted. This could⁢ be due to various factors,including the‍ degradation of components within the bulb or issues‌ with the power supply.

Q2: ​Which ⁢electronic components are crucial for the operation⁤ of LED​ light bulbs?
A2: LED light bulbs comprise several key components, including ‍the LED chip itself, resistors, capacitors, ⁣and a power ​driver (or driver⁢ circuit). Each⁤ of these ⁢plays a role in converting ⁢electrical ​energy into light and maintaining the ‌bulb’s ​performance over time.Q3: How can the ​driver⁣ circuit contribute to fading?
A3: The ​driver circuit controls the amount of⁣ current ‍that flows‍ to the LED chip. If it ⁤becomes faulty or‌ inefficient—perhaps due to aging⁢ components like capacitors that ‌have‌ dried out—it may regulate⁢ the current poorly,⁣ leading⁢ to inconsistent ‌brightness or premature⁣ fading‌ of the LED.

Q4: Are⁤ resistors related to the fading of LED⁣ bulbs?
A4: Yes, resistors are⁣ used to control ⁣the voltage and ​current flowing⁢ to the ​leds.If a resistor fails⁢ or ⁢if ‍it’s incorrectly rated, ⁢this can⁣ lead⁣ to either too much⁤ or ‌too little current reaching the LED,⁢ causing it⁤ to fade​ faster ⁣then‍ it ⁤normally would.

Q5: What role do ⁤capacitors play in an LED bulb?
A5: capacitors in an LED light bulb help to smooth out fluctuations⁣ in electrical current. When capacitors age or malfunction,⁣ they can ⁣fail to maintain a consistent current flow, which can result⁤ in dimming or fading of the LED over⁢ time.

Q6: Can external factors also ‌cause an LED ⁢bulb ​to fade?
A6: Absolutely. External‌ factors such as ​voltage fluctuations in the electrical supply, excessive heat,‌ or⁣ uneven ‍airflow can impact ‍the lifespan and brightness of LED bulbs. For instance, prolonged exposure ⁤to high temperatures can‌ accelerate⁢ the deterioration of internal ​components,⁤ leading​ to‌ fading.

Q7: Is fading an LED bulb something that can⁤ be prevented?
A7: ⁤While some degree of ​fading is inevitable over⁣ time due‌ to ​the​ natural ‍aging of components, choosing ‍high-quality ⁣LED bulbs with robust‍ driver ‌designs,‍ proper heat management practices,‍ and using⁣ them within ⁣recommended voltage ranges can ⁢help⁤ mitigate fading and extend their lifespan.

Q8: What should⁣ consumers look‌ for to⁣ ensure longer-lasting brightness from their ‍LED bulbs?
A8: Consumers should‍ opt for LED bulbs ‍from reputable brands, ⁤looking for specifications that indicate better ​build ⁤quality, such as high-quality ⁣drivers, ⁢thermal management features (like heat sinks), and warranties that reflect the manufacturer’s‌ confidence in​ their product’s longevity.
